Value of Early Dental Gos To



Recognizing the importance of early oral brows through can establish the structure for a kid's lifelong dental wellness. Developing a connection with a pediatric dental expert as early as the eruption of the first tooth, generally around six months old, is crucial. These preliminary check outs not only acquaint youngsters with the oral atmosphere but also enable very early detection of potential problems, such as misalignment or tooth cavities.


Very early oral check-ups encourage caretakers with useful knowledge regarding correct dental care, nutritional recommendations, and the avoidance of dental diseases. Pediatric dentists are skilled in resolving the distinct needs of kids, ensuring that they obtain age-appropriate education on dental hygiene. In addition, these sees offer a possibility to go over habits such as thumb-sucking and pacifier usage, which can impact oral advancement.


Crucial Oral Hygiene Practices



Developing a strong foundation for a youngster's oral wellness exceeds routine oral gos to; it additionally involves instilling efficient dental hygiene practices from a very early age. Caregivers and moms and dads play a crucial function in training children proper methods to maintain their oral health and wellness.

First, it is necessary to begin cleaning as quickly as the first tooth appears, ut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and a little quantity of fluoride tooth paste. For youngsters under three years old, a smear of toothpaste suffices; for youngsters aged 3 to 6, a pea-sized quantity is appropriate - kid dentist near me. Encouraging brushing twice a day, ideally in the morning and before bedtime, helps develop a routine


Flossing ought to begin when 2 teeth touch, as this stops plaque buildup in hard-to-reach areas. Moms and dads need to help their children with brushing and flossing until they have to do with 7 or eight years of ages to guarantee thoroughness.


Additionally, establishing regular oral exams every 6 months permits expert tracking of oral health. Instructing kids the value of oral hygiene and making it an enjoyable, interesting task can promote lifelong healthy and balanced behaviors that are essential in avoiding common oral problems.

Role of Nutrition in Dental Wellness



Nourishment plays a critical duty in maintaining ideal oral health, as the foods kids eat can considerably influence the development and stamina of their teeth. A healthy diet rich in necessary vitamins and minerals is crucial for developing solid enamel and supporting general dental health and wellness.


Alternatively, a diet plan high in acids and sugars can result in detrimental impacts on oral wellness. Sugary snacks and drinks can foster the growth of damaging bacteria in the mouth, resulting in raised level of acidity and a higher risk of dental cavity. It is necessary for caregivers to motivate much healthier treat choices, such as f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, which not only give needed nutrients however also advertise saliva manufacturing, more shielding teeth.


Typical Oral Troubles in Kid



Dental health concerns are a typical problem for numerous parents, as kids can experience a variety of issues that might impact their dental well-being. One prevalent problem is dental caries, or dental caries, which emerge from the demineralization of tooth enamel because of acid-producing germs. This problem is commonly aggravated by poor dietary habits, such as frequent usage of sugary snacks and drinks.


One more common problem is malocclusion, where teeth are misaligned, bring about troubles in biting, eating, and speaking. This can arise from hereditary aspects or practices such as thumb sucking and long term pacifier usage. In addition, gingivitis, a very early type of periodontal illness, can happen in children, usually because of inadequate dental health methods. It is characterized by red, inflamed gum tissues that might hemorrhage throughout brushing.


Tooth injuries, including fractures or avulsions, are likewise regular amongst active children. These can arise from drops, sporting activities, or crashes. Early recognition and treatment are vital in taking care of these troubles to stop additional difficulties. Regular oral examinations play a vital role in identifying and attending to these usual oral concerns properly.


Structure Lifelong Dental Habits



Instilling great dental health techniques early in life sets the structure for a lifetime of healthy teeth and gum tissues. Establishing a constant routine for brushing and flossing is crucial; children should brush their teeth two times a day with fluoride tooth paste and start flossing as quickly as 2 nearby teeth touch. Parents play a crucial function in modeling these actions, as children often copy adult methods.






Educating children concerning the significance of dental treatment can further enhance these routines. Use engaging approaches, such as tales or interactive video games, to aid them understand why routine dental visits and appropriate health are crucial. In addition, introducing a well balanced diet regimen low in sugar can substantially minimize the danger of tooth cavities and promote oral health and wellness.
